## About This Project
This project is for a fully customizable AI persona usable for streaming or private companionship. Feel free to download and use how you wish.
This software uses libraries from the FFmpeg project under the LGPLv2.1
## Key Features
- Realtime promptable AI personality with text and speech input
- Support for MCP
- REST API and websocket server for building applications on top of this server
- Options to run fully local

## Install From Scratch
> **Note**
> To simplify setup across platforms, setup now uses [conda](https://docs.conda.io/projects/conda/en/stable/user-guide/install/index.html). Conda is not necessary to run this project.
### Setup and install dependencies
Create and enter a virtual environment with Python ^3.10 and pip 24.0.
For example, using conda:
```bash
conda create -n jaison-core python=3.10 pip=24.0 -y
conda activate jaison-core
```
<hr />
Install [PyTorch 2.7.1](https://pytorch.org/get-started/previous-versions/) with the right integration. Example below for computers with RTX graphics card.
```bash
pip install torch torchvision torchaudio --index-url https://download.pytorch.org/whl/cu128
```
> For NVidia cards, ensure you have the latest drivers and [CUDA toolkit](https://developer.nvidia.com/cuda-toolkit)
> Dealing with duplicate `libiomp5md.dll`.
>
> It might not be necessary, but in case you encounter this error when running:
>
> 1. Go to environment directory (where conda stores installed packages)
> 2. Search for `libiomp5md.dll`
> 3. Delete the version under package `torch`
<hr />
Install dependencies.
```bash
# Inside project root where this README is located
pip install -r requirements.txt
pip install --no-deps -r requirements.no_deps.txt
python -m spacy download en_core_web_sm
python install.py
python -m unidic download
```
> If on Windows, please enable [Developer Mode](https://learn.microsoft.com/en-us/windows/apps/get-started/enable-your-device-for-development)
<hr />
Install FFmpeg
#### For Ubuntu/Debian users
```bash
sudo apt install ffmpeg
```
#### For MacOS users
```bash
brew install ffmpeg
```
#### For Windows users
Download executables and place them in the root folder:
- [Download latest `ffmpeg-git-essentials.7z`](https://www.gyan.dev/ffmpeg/builds/)
- Extract and copy all contents from `bin/` to root of this project.
<hr />
Configuration
**FOR A FREE, 3RD PARTY T2T INTEGRATION**: Use `openai` type but configure for use with [Groq](https://console.groq.com/home).
Add keys and other sensitive information for services you intend to use in `.env` (make a new file and copy the contents of [`.env-template`](.env-template)).
For immediate setup using the example configuration, just provide the OpenAI API key.
Overall configuration can be done in `configs/` and an example with all configurable options is located in `configs/example.yaml`. See [Development guide](DEVELOPER.md) for details on configuration.
## How To Use
While using the virtual environment with the installation.
```bash
python ./src/main.py --help
```
Example usage: `python ./src/main.py --config=example`
